| | The King James Version Online Bible (KJV) | The Darby Online Bible (DBY) | The Basic English Online Bible (BAS) | The Webster Online Bible (WEB) |
| Job 18:1 | Then answered Bildad the Shuhite, and said, | And Bildad the Shuhite answered and said, | Then Bildad the Shuhite made answer and said, | Then answered Bildad the Shuhite, and said, |
| Job 18:2 | How long will it be ere ye make an end of words? mark, and afterwards we will speak. | How long will ye hunt for words? Be intelligent, and then we will speak. | How long will it be before you have done talking? Get wisdom, and then we will say what is in our minds. | How long will it be ere ye make an end of words? mark, and afterwards we will speak. |
| Job 18:3 | Wherefore are we counted as beasts, and reputed vile in your sight? | Wherefore are we counted as beasts, and reputed stupid in your sight? | Why do we seem as beasts in your eyes, and as completely without knowledge? | Why are we counted as beasts, and reputed vile in your sight? |
| Job 18:4 | He teareth himself in his anger: shall the earth be forsaken for thee? and shall the rock be removed out of his place? | Thou that tearest thyself in thine anger, shall the earth be forsaken for thee? and shall the rock be removed out of its place? | But come back, now, come: you who are wounding yourself in your passion, will the earth be given up because of you, or a rock be moved out of its place? | He teareth himself in his anger: shall the earth be forsaken for thee? and shall the rock be removed out of its place? |
| Job 18:5 | Yea, the light of the wicked shall be put out, and the spark of his fire shall not shine. | Yea, the light of the wicked shall be put out, and the flame of his fire shall not shine. | For the light of the sinner is put out, and the flame of his fire is not shining. | Yes, the light of the wicked shall be put out, and the spark of his fire shall not shine. |
| Job 18:6 | The light shall be dark in his tabernacle, and his candle shall be put out with him. | The light shall become dark in his tent, and his lamp over him shall be put out. | The light is dark in his tent, and the light shining over him is put out. | The light shall be dark in his tabernacle, and his candle shall be put out with him. |
| Job 18:7 | The steps of his strength shall be straitened, and his own counsel shall cast him down. | The steps of his strength shall be straitened, and his own counsel shall cast him down. | The steps of his strength become short, and by his design destruction overtakes him. | The steps of his strength shall be straitened, and his own counsel shall cast him down. |
| Job 18:8 | For he is cast into a net by his own feet, and he walketh upon a snare. | For he is sent into the net by his own feet, and he walketh on the meshes; | His feet take him into the net, and he goes walking into the cords. | For he is cast into a net by his own feet, and he walketh upon a snare. |
| Job 18:9 | The gin shall take him by the heel, and the robber shall prevail against him. | The gin taketh [him] by the heel, the snare layeth hold on him; | His foot is taken in the net; he comes into its grip. | The gin shall take him by the heel, and the robber shall prevail against him. |
| Job 18:10 | The snare is laid for him in the ground, and a trap for him in the way. | A cord is hidden for him in the ground, and his trap in the way. | The twisted cord is put secretly in the earth to take him, and the cord is placed in his way. | The snare is laid for him in the ground, and a trap for him in the way. |
| Job 18:11 | Terrors shall make him afraid on every side, and shall drive him to his feet. | Terrors make him afraid on every side, and chase him at his footsteps. | He is overcome by fears on every side, they go after him at every step. | Terrors shall make him afraid on every side, and shall drive him to his feet. |
| Job 18:12 | His strength shall be hungerbitten, and destruction shall be ready at his side. | His strength is hunger-bitten, and calamity is ready at his side. | His strength is made feeble for need of food, and destruction is waiting for his falling footstep. | His strength shall be hunger-bitten, and destruction shall be ready at his side. |
| Job 18:13 | It shall devour the strength of his skin: even the firstborn of death shall devour his strength. | The firstborn of death devoureth the members of his body; it will devour his members. | His skin is wasted by disease, and his body is food for the worst of diseases. | It shall devour the strength of his skin: even the first-born of death shall devour his strength. |
| Job 18:14 | His confidence shall be rooted out of his tabernacle, and it shall bring him to the king of terrors. | His confidence shall be rooted out of his tent, and it shall lead him away to the king of terrors: | He is pulled out of his tent where he was safe, and he is taken away to the king of fears. | His confidence shall be rooted out of his tabernacle, and it shall bring him to the king of terrors. |
| Job 18:15 | It shall dwell in his tabernacle, because it is none of his: brimstone shall be scattered upon his habitation. | They who are none of his shall dwell in his tent; brimstone shall be showered upon his habitation: | In his tent will be seen that which is not his, burning stone is dropped on his house. | It shall dwell in his tabernacle, because it is none of his: brimstone shall be scattered upon his habitation. |
| Job 18:16 | His roots shall be dried up beneath, and above shall his branch be cut off. | His roots shall be dried up beneath, and above shall his branch be cut off; | Under the earth his roots are dry, and over it his branch is cut off. | His roots shall be dried up beneath, and above shall his branch be cut off. |
| Job 18:17 | His remembrance shall perish from the earth, and he shall have no name in the street. | His remembrance shall perish from the earth, and he shall have no name on the pasture-grounds. | His memory is gone from the earth, and in the open country there is no knowledge of his name. | His remembrance shall perish from the earth, and he shall have no name in the street. |
| Job 18:18 | He shall be driven from light into darkness, and chased out of the world. | He is driven from light into darkness, and chased out of the world. | He is sent away from the light into the dark; he is forced out of the world. | He shall be driven from light into darkness, and chased out of the world. |
| Job 18:19 | He shall neither have son nor nephew among his people, nor any remaining in his dwellings. | He hath neither son nor grandson among his people, nor any remaining in the places of his sojourn. | He has no offspring or family among his people, and in his living-place there is no one of his name. | He shall neither have son nor nephew among his people, nor any remaining in his dwellings. |
| Job 18:20 | They that come after him shall be astonied at his day, as they that went before were affrighted. | They that come after shall be astonished at his day, as they that went before [them] were affrighted. | At his fate those of the west are shocked, and those of the east are overcome with fear. | They that come after him shall be astonished at his day, as they that went before were affrighted. |
| Job 18:21 | Surely such are the dwellings of the wicked, and this is the place of him that knoweth not God. | Surely, such are the dwellings of the unrighteous man, and such the place of him that knoweth not ùGod. | Truly, these are the houses of the sinner, and this is the place of him who has no knowledge of God. | Surely such are the dwellings of the wicked, and this is the place of him that knoweth not God. |
